Texas Southern University Vs. Mississippi Valley State University Financial Aid Comparison

In average, 95%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Texas Southern University Vs. Mississippi Valley State University. The average financial aid amount received is $11,023.
For all undergraduate students, 80.00%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$8,890
The 2024 average tuition & fees for the schools is $8,294 for state residents and $14,843 for out-of-state students.
The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Texas Southern University Vs. Mississippi Valley State University is $30,762 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$19,739.
